Kenneth W. Aldrich, age 88, of Toledo, Ohio and formally of Florida, passed away, Wednesday, March 9, 2011 at the home of his daughter. He was born in Toledo on April 3, 1922 to Ralph and Margaret Aldrich.
Kenneth was a veteran of the United States Navy Seabees. His passions include playing golf, bowling and fishing.
Ken was a lifetime member of V.F.W. #606.
He was preceded in death by his beloved wife, Rita.
Kenneth is survived by his devoted children, Kenneth M. (LaVerne) Aldrich, Kit (Edwin) Glynn, Marcie (Robert) Retzloff, Christopher Aldrich: grandchildren, Lori (Aaron), Andrew (Leslie), Brad (Julie), Brandon (Jessica), Michael, Sarah: great grandchildren, Rain, Tina, Wyn, Aidan, Lydia and sibling Verna Kay and Donald Aldrich.
Visitation for Kenneth will be at H. H. Birkenkamp Funeral Home, 3219 Tremainsville Rd (at Alexis) 419-473-1301 on Sunday, March 13, 2011 from 2:00 pm until 8:00 pm. Funeral services are 10:00 am on Monday. Interment to follow at Calvary Cemetery. Memorial contributions may be given to Hospice of Northwest Ohio, 30000 E. River Rd, Perrysburg, Ohio.
